Fabric London Will Reopen!

Fabric have confirmed a new deal has been agreed with the Metropolitan police and Islington council.

 
After a lengthy battle, Fabric appears to have been saved!
 
The new agreement which has been reached will see fabric open once again with new licensing conditions. The opening date is still to be confirmed but it s understood that a number of key changes will happen in the club including:

 

– The use of a new I.D. scanning system on entry to the club
– Enhanced searching procedures and controls
– Covert surveillance within the club
– Life-time bans for anyone found in possession of drugs, whether on entry or within the club
– Life-time bands for anyone trying to buy drugs in the club
– Enhanced monitoring and external auditing for compliance against procedures
– Physical changes to the club, including improved lighting and additional CCTV provision
– A new Security Company
– Persons under 19 years of age shall not be permitted to be on the premises as a customer or guest from 2000 hours on a Friday until 0800 hours on the following Monday or on any day during the hours that the operators promote a Core Club Night.
